Stantec is looking for an experienced Civil Engineer-in-Training (EIT) with the ability to work as a team member on a wide range of land development projects under the guidance of a Staff Level Engineer or Project Manager. The desired candidate will perform a variety of tasks which may include engineering analysis, calculations, exhibits preparation, and construction documents. While it is not expected that the desired EIT will be fully proficient in all the various tasks described above, it is anticipated that this person has spent two to three years working in the civil engineering field performing tasks in the land development realm and is on their way to achieving competence.
